"BPL is a Pandora's Box of Unprecedented Proportions" By Rick Lindquist, N1RL (ARRL) -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- https://www.arrl.org/forms/development/donations/bpl/ Here's the situation... Utility companies with deep pockets are promoting a new scheme -- with great potential for causing harmful interference to Amateur Radio operators nationwide. The FCC is considering possible rule changes to aid these commercial interests who want to use existing electrical power lines that run along nearly every street and road, and into every neighborhood, to carry high-speed Internet service into homes and offices. Why is this important to you? Broadband over Power Line ("Access BPL") feeds broadband digital signals onto power lines using high-frequency RF from 2 to 80 MHz -- right on top of 80 meters, 40 meters, 20 meters and every other popular ham band all the way up to 6 meters. And it's not just the ham bands -- short-wave listeners are at risk too. Although this technology is already allowed, the industry wants the limits to be relaxed -- with greater interference potential to your ham radio operation. These BPL signals could transform HF from a quiet haven that hams enjoy to a noisy industry wasteland, changing ham radio forever. It's already hard enough to maintain a regular schedule with your friends, hear weak DX signals, or copy a maritime ham in distress. Imagine trying to do that through several S-units or more of broadband garbage. Imagine not even being able to throw your rig in the car and escape it through mobile operation -- power lines are everywhere! Will you have to operate from a remote site just to enjoy a quiet QSO? .. . . David Sumner, K1ZZ ARRL Chief Executive Officer |
